Qual a diferença de inner JOIN para left JOIN?
INNER JOIN: Retorna apenas os registros que têm correspondência em ambas as tabelas. É útil quando se deseja ver interseções diretas. LEFT (OUTER) JOIN: Retorna todos os registros da tabela à esquerda, juntamente com os registros correspondentes (se houver) da tabela à direita.Para que serve o inner JOIN?
Esse é o tipo de junção mais comum. As junções internas combinam registros de duas tabelas sempre que houver valores correspondentes em um campo comum a ambas as tabelas. Você pode usar INNER JOIN com as tabelas Departamentos e Funcionários para selecionar todos os funcionários em cada departamento.Qual a diferença entre left JOIN e left outer JOIN?
Onde podemos destacar a parte {LEFT|RIGHT} [OUTER] . Os colchetes em volta de OUTER indicam que ele é opcional na SQL e, portanto, será considerado por omissão. Ou seja, LEFT JOIN e LEFT OUTER JOIN são exatamente a mesma coisa.O que faz o left JOIN?
Use uma operação LEFT JOIN para criar um junção esquerda externa. As junções externas esquerdas incluem todos os registros da primeira (à esquerda) das duas tabelas, mesmo que não haja nenhum valor correspondente para os registros na segunda tabela (à direita).Qual a diferença entre INNER e LEFT JOIN? | CreateSe
O que faz o cross JOIN?
A cláusula CROSS JOIN retorna todas as linhas das tabelas por cruzamento, ou seja, para cada linha da tabela esquerda queremos todos os linhas da tabelas direita ou vice-versa. Ele também é chamado de produto cartesiano entre duas tabelas.Qual é a diferença entre inner JOIN e outer JOIN no PostgreSQL?
Enquanto os INNER JOINs combinam apenas as linhas que têm correspondência nas duas tabelas, os OUTER JOINs, por outro lado, retornam não apenas as linhas correspondentes, mas também as linhas que não têm correspondência em uma ou ambas as tabelas.O que é outer JOIN?
O FULL OUTER JOIN é uma operação crucial em SQL que permite combinar linhas de duas ou mais tabelas com base em uma coluna relacionada entre elas, mesmo se não houver correspondência direta. Dito de outra forma, ele retorna todas as linhas das tabelas envolvidas, preenchendo com NULL onde não existem correspondências.O que é left outer?
O LEFT OUTER JOIN, frequentemente apenas chamado LEFT JOIN, é uma operação SQL que retorna todos os registros da tabela da esquerda (tabela base), juntamente com os registros correspondentes (quando houver) da tabela da direita (tabela secundária).Qual é o resultado de uma junção à esquerda (left join)?
A resposta correta é a alternativa B: "Retorna todas as linhas da tabela à direita e as linhas correspondentes da tabela à esquerda".Como montar inner JOIN?
Para utilizar o Inner Join corretamente, é necessário compreender alguns conceitos-chave:
- Chave primária. ...
- Chave estrangeira. ...
- Condição de junção. ...
- Identifique as tabelas e as colunas relevantes. ...
- Escreva a sintaxe do Inner Join. ...
- Utilize aliases para as tabelas. ...
- Otimize suas consultas.
Quais são os tipos de JOINs?
Existem cinco tipos de JOIN, que realizam consultas de formas diferentes nas tabelas do banco de dados, o INNER JOIN, LEFT JOIN, RIGHT JOIN, FULL JOIN e CROSS JOIN.O que é uma subconsulta em SQL?
Uma subconsulta é uma instrução SELECT aninhada dentro de um SELECT, SELECT... INTO, INSERT...Para que serve o JOIN no SQL?
Ela cria um conjunto que pode ser salvo como uma tabela ou usado da forma como está. Um JOIN é um meio de combinar colunas de uma (auto-junção) ou mais tabelas, usando valores comuns a cada uma delas. O SQL padrão ANSI especifica cinco tipos de JOIN : INNER , LEFT OUTER , RIGHT OUTER , FULL OUTER e CROSS .O que são subconsultas em um banco de dados relacional?
O que são subconsultas (subqueries)Subconsultas, ou consultas aninhadas, são "consultas dentro de consultas". A idéia da subconsulta é usar o resultado de um comando SELECT como entrada para outro comando SELECT. Mas podemos usar a subconsulta (além do SELECT) também com INSERT, UPDATE ou DELETE.
Qual clausula SQL é usada para inserir dados em uma tabela?
INSERT - Inserindo dados na tabelaPara usar o INSERT devemos escrever INSERT INTO e o nome da tabela. Depois colocar em parênteses as colunas que terão um valor inseridos, escrever VALUES e escrever em outro parênteses os valores que serão inseridos nas colunas.
Qual a diferença entre join e left join?
Portanto, enquanto INNER JOIN nos dá apenas as combinações perfeitas entre duas listas, LEFT JOIN garante que todos os itens da primeira lista estejam presentes, mesmo que não haja correspondências na segunda lista.Qual a diferença entre join e inner join?
A única diferença é a forma de escrita, pois o resultado será o mesmo. Porém é recomendado que se user Inner Join, pois deixa o código mais claro sobre o que realmente está sendo feito (melhora a leitura), especialmente quando é realizado outros Joins na mesma consulta, como o Left Join, Right Join, entre outros.O que é um left?
esquerda {f.}Qual a diferença entre full outer JOIN e cross JOIN?
Cross Join = todos os registros ligados de A e B, todas as linhas de A e todas as linhas de B, além de réplicas das linhas de A e B com variações entre registros das mesmas tabelas. Full Join = Left Join e Right Join juntos. As linhas que não são ligadas não aparecem.Qual é o tipo de JOIN mais comum e eficiente?
1. Inner Join: – O Inner Join é o tipo mais comum de Join utilizado em consultas SQL. Ele retorna apenas as linhas que possuem correspondência em ambas as tabelas envolvidas na consulta.Como fazer full outer JOIN?
Dica: FULL OUTER JOIN e FULL JOIN significam a mesma função. Dessa forma, para consertar a situação, basta substituir os valores da primeira tabela pelo E3TimeStamp da segunda tabela. Assim, os valores das colunas coincidirão, e por isso os valores de retorno não serão nulos.O que faz o left outer JOIN?
Use a operação LEFT JOIN para criar uma junção externa esquerda. As junções externas esquerdas incluem todos os registros da primeira de duas tabelas (a da esquerda), mesmo se não houver valores correspondentes na segunda tabela (à direita). Use uma operação RIGHT JOIN para criar uma junção externa direita.Como funciona o inner JOIN?
O INNER JOIN é uma operação que retorna registros quando há pelo menos uma correspondência em ambas as tabelas sendo unidas. Em outras palavras, apenas os registros que têm pares correspondentes nas outras tabelas são retornados.Como fazer JOIN postgres?
Joins no PostgreSQLQuanto à sintaxe, ela é bem intuitiva. Se quiser juntar todas as colunas tanto de uma tabela, quanto da outra, basta colocar um asterisco depois do SELECT , indicar a primeira tabela com FROM , chamar o INNER JOIN e indicar a segunda tabela.